What's the snapshot length you're using in the "pcap_open_live()" calls
you're doing explicitly?  68?

Yeah, 68, though from my cursory search I didn't see that value getting
passed to the kernel?

It's somewhat obscure how it happens.

There's no ioctl in BPF to set the snapshot length.  However, a BPF
program terminates by returning with a numerical value; if the value is
0, the packet is discarded (i.e., it didn't pass the filter), but if
it's non-zero, the non-zero value is the snapshot length.

The BPF code generator in libpcap generates code that returns either 0
or the snapshot length.
